Acquiring an FSSAI License for Olive Oil Manufacturers: A Step-by-Step Guide
The first thing that the applicant needs to do is to access the official website of FoSCOS, the Food Safety Compliance System.
Before applying, it is very important to decide whether a Central or State License is to be obtained. Each location should be separately entered to decide on its eligibility.
Once the website is loaded, click "Sign-up" for the desired license type. Fill in the registration form with contact details, whereby the phone number and email address provided will be active and accessible.
Choose a unique username and set up a password during registration. Upon completion of the form, click 'Register' to finalize the sign-up.
Confirmation of account activation via an SMS and email to the applicant after successful registration.
Use your new credentials to log into the system and fill out the online FSSAI Registration Application Form. All details should be correct and complete.
Before submitting online, print a copy of it. Once submitted online, a reference number will appear on the screen, very important for tracking the application process.
Within 15 days of applying online, a photocopy of the filled application form should be sent to the respective regional or state FSSAI office. This is so that the application is considered and processed.
FSSAI License Fees for Olive Oil Manufacturers vary based on the license type. The government fee starts at ₹100 for Basic Registration, ₹2,000 for a State License, and ₹7,500 for a Central License. Additionally, professional fees for application processing and documentation support are ₹2,000 for Basic Registration, ₹3,500 for a State License, and ₹5,000 for a Central License.

Yes, every food business operator, including manufacturers of olive oil, must obtain the FSSAI license to be eligible to function in India.
If the annual turnover is less than ₹12 lakh, it requires a Basic FSSAI Registration. Bigger turnovers require a State or a Central license.
The FSSAI license is valid for a period of 1 to 5 years, depending on your choice at the time of the application. Before expiry, it must be renewed; otherwise, penalties are imposed.
Yes, but a Central FSSAI License has to be obtained along with an Import Export Code (IEC) and other export documents.
Penalties could go up to ₹5 lakh or even imprisonment, depending on the nature of the violation, if found working without an FSSAI license.
Basically, this takes a time period of around 7 to 60 days, according to the category of license and the document verification process.
